वर्गमूल सर्पिल में \(\sqrt{15}\) के बाद कौन-सा कर्ण बनेगा?

In a square root spiral, which hypotenuse will be formed after \(\sqrt{15}\)?

Author: Muft Shiksha Editorial Team Published:
Explanation opens after your attempt
Correct Answer

C. \(\sqrt{16}\)

Step 1

Concept

At each step the next hypotenuse is \(\sqrt{n+1}\). Therefore \(\sqrt{16}\) is formed after \(\sqrt{15}\).
